Marchiafava-Bignami illness is a rare neurological disorder characterised by demyelination and necrosis of the corpus callosum, which is frequently linked to prolonged alcoholism and starvation. We describe a 25-year-old female patient with chronic alcoholism who had visual hallucinations, flashes of light in her eyes, and impaired vision for the second time and was experiencing the same symptoms.
